    Review by 'baggag1' on item 'Zune HD 16 GB Video MP3 Player (Black)'

    I'm no audiophile, but, I like good sounding music and this device delivers. I primarily wanted to get a device that received H.D radio and this filled the bill and then some. I like this because it does my music library, pictures, videos, audio books. games, etc.

    Need some in-ear phones for Motorcycling

    I ride a lot here and have found that the Shure orange foam sleeves do the best with my IEM's. Good noise isolation makes for good sound reproduction. But hence I'm old and listen to AM radio mostly.
